Job description

  • Set the data engineering and platform delivery direction across FDSS data use cases.
  • Turn prototype pipelines, models and demonstrations into repeatable production services.
  • Coordinate data engineering, platform, analytics, ML, security, governance and operational disciplines around a single delivery roadmap., * Own the Data Intelligence Platform engineering strategy, target architecture, roadmap and productionisation standards.
  • Lead design and delivery of ingestion, event streaming, transformation, lakehouse, serving and analytical data products.
  • Establish engineering patterns for batch and low-latency data, APIs, feature pipelines and authorised data access.
  • Define and implement data quality, lineage, metadata, catalogue, master/reference data and reconciliation controls.
  • Embed CI/CD, Infrastructure as Code, automated testing, observability, FinOps and secure configuration into the platform lifecycle.
  • Lead production readiness across resilience, scalability, backup, recovery, monitoring, support, data protection and service management.
  • Coordinate platform dependencies, environments, suppliers and interfaces with wider FDSS and ESCS services.
  • Set technical priorities, estimate delivery, manage engineering risks and mentor data engineers.
  • Support governance and stakeholder decisions with transparent measures of platform quality, readiness, performance and value.

Requirements

  • Data engineering leadership and platform architecture
  • Cloud data platforms and lakehouse patterns
  • Batch, streaming and event-driven data pipelines
  • SQL, Python and distributed data processing
  • Data modelling, data products and semantic layers
  • Data quality, observability, lineage, metadata and cataloguing
  • Data governance, security, privacy and access control
  • MLOps and productionisation of analytical or AI services
  • CI/CD, Infrastructure as Code and automated data testing
  • Reliability engineering, FinOps and service transition

Required experience:

  • Leadership of data engineering delivery for a production cloud data platform.
  • Experience taking prototypes, notebooks or analytical use cases through production engineering and operational acceptance.
  • Experience designing scalable ingestion, transformation and serving patterns.
  • Experience implementing data quality, governance, security and platform observability.
  • Experience coordinating product, analytics, engineering, infrastructure, security and operational stakeholders.

Desired experience:

  • Databricks, Microsoft Fabric, Azure data services, AWS data services or comparable platforms.
  • Data Intelligence Platform, digital supply chain, logistics or defence data use cases.
  • Event streaming, feature stores, MLOps or AI/ML platform engineering.
  • Migration of sensitive enterprise data and integration with operational systems.
  • Experience establishing a data platform team, engineering standards and reusable accelerators.

About the company

Leidos UK & EUROPE (http://www.leidos.com/company/global/uk-europe) - we work to make the worldsafer,healthier, andmore efficient through technology, engineering andscience.

Leidos is a growing company delivering innovative technology and solutions focused on safeguarding critical capabilities and transformation in frontline services, our work in the United Kingdom includes addressing some of the most complex problems in defence, healthcare, government, safety and security, and transportation.
